It's certainly not a huge number, but according to new figures just published by the Census Bureau, the population of New York State has dropped by nearly 2,000 people.

At the end of 2015, the state had 19,747,183 residents.  The bureau says we now have 19,745,289 people living here.  However, the Empire State still has over 367,000 more people living here than it did in 2010.

We are not alone.  Several other states in the Northeast have also saw a decline in their population during the past year.  They include Connecticut and Vermont.

Where are the people going?  According to the Census Bureau, Texas, Florida, California, Washington and Arizona are the states with the biggest increases this past year.
